3 Create the Simple Workflow Example Schema on page 68
You create a workflow schema in the Schema tab of the workflow editor. The workflow schema contains
the elements that the workflow runs.
4 Link the Simple Workflow Example Elements on page 69
You link a workflow's elements in the Schema tab of the workflow editor. The linking defines the flow
of data through the workflow.
5 Create Workflow Zones on page 71
You can emphasize different zones in workflow by adding workflow notes of different colors. Creating
different workflow zones helps to make complicated workflow schema easier to read and understand.
6 Define the Simple Workflow Example Decision Bindings on page 72
You bind a workflow's elements together in the Schema tab of the workflow editor. Decision bindings
define how decision elements compare the input parameters received to the decision statement, and
generate output parameters according to whether the input parameters match the decision statement.
7 Bind the Simple Workflow Example Action Elements on page 73
You bind a workflow's elements together in the Schema tab of the workflow editor. Bindings define how
the action elements process input parameters and generate output parameters.
8 Bind the Simple Workflow Example Scripted Task Elements on page 75
You bind a workflow's elements together in the Schema tab of the workflow editor. Bindings define how
the scripted task elements process input parameters and generate output parameters. You also bind the
scriptable task elements to their JavaScript functions.
9 Define the Simple Example Workflow Exception Bindings on page 82
You define exception bindings in the Schema tab in the workflow editor. Exception bindings define how
elements process errors.
10 Set the Simple Workflow Example Attribute Read-Write Properties on page 82
You can define whether parameters and attributes are read-only constants or writeable variables. You
can also set limitations on the values that users can provide for input parameters.
11 Set the Simple Workflow Example Parameter Properties on page 83
You set the parameter properties in the Presentation tab in the workflow editor. Setting the parameter
properties affects the behavior of the parameter, and places constraints on the possible values for that
parameter.
12 Set the Layout of the Simple Workflow Example Input Parameters Dialog Box on page 84
You create the layout, or presentation, of the input parameters dialog box in the Presentation tab of the
workflow editor. The input parameters dialog box opens when users run a workflow, and is the means
by which users enter the input parameters with which the workflow runs.
13 Validate and Run the Simple Workflow Example on page 85
After you create a workflow, you can validate it to discover any possible errors. If the workflow contains
no errors, you can run it.
